Add a little extra

Just adding a little extra exercise here and there can really make a difference.  This week my ‘little extra’ was adding 10 more stability ball crunches from the totals the week before. So instead of 50 I did 60 stability ball crunches.

P.S.S  The rebounding/mini trampoline challenge starts next Monday, March 29th and will run for 5 days. The goal is to complete 1 hour of rebounding in that time which averages out to 12 minutes a day. This challenge is meant to get you going on the rebounder trampoline so you can see what a healthy and FUN exercise it can be.  If you don’t have a mini trampoline and can get outside on a full size one by all means go for it but they are much different from each other just so you know.
